Pharmaceutical microbiology is a branch of microbiology that deals with the study of microorganisms relevant to pharmaceutical products. This field focuses on ensuring the safety and efficacy of pharmaceutical products by studying the presence and behavior of microorganisms in drug development, manufacturing, and storage processes. It also involves monitoring and controlling microbial contamination in pharmaceutical products to maintain quality standards.

Agar is commonly used in food products such as desserts, jellies, and confectionery. It is also used in microbiology as a growth medium for bacteria and in the pharmaceutical industry for making capsules.
